Transaction d608a4f9027dd1f2839d72190ffd86392ec7713b662e6ff90488cad7e7a16525
1 Input
1 Output
-
d608a4f9027dd1f2839d72190ffd86392ec7713b662e6ff90488cad7e7a16525:0
- value
- 590157
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b99d6307d69fd15adcf47bc40cacb61769ce8f4
- address
- bc1qawvavvrad873ttw0g77ypjktv9mfe685ut4ffq